Vmware Spring Advanced Message Queuing Protocol vulnerabilities

4 known vulnerabilities affecting vmware/spring_advanced_message_queuing_protocol.

Total CVEs
4
CISA KEV
0
Public exploits
0
Exploited in wild
0
Severity breakdown
CRITICAL1MEDIUM3

Vulnerabilities

Page 1 of 1
CVE-2023-34050MEDIUMCVSS 4.3≥ 1.0.0, < 2.4.16≥ 3.0.0, < 3.0.92023-10-19
CVE-2023-34050 [MEDIUM] CWE-502 CVE-2023-34050: In spring AMQP versions 1.0.0 to 2.4.16 and 3.0.0 to 3.0.9 , allowed list patterns for des In spring AMQP versions 1.0.0 to 2.4.16 and 3.0.0 to 3.0.9 , allowed list patterns for deserializable class names were added to Spring AMQP, allowing users to lock down deserialization of data in messages from untrusted sources; however by default, when no allowed list was provided, all classes could be deserialized. Specifically, an application i
nvd
CVE-2021-22095MEDIUMCVSS 6.5≥ 2.2.0, < 2.2.19≥ 2.3.0, < 2.3.112021-11-30
CVE-2021-22095 [MEDIUM] CWE-502 CVE-2021-22095: In Spring AMQP versions 2.2.0 - 2.2.19 and 2.3.0 - 2.3.11, the Spring AMQP Message object, in its to In Spring AMQP versions 2.2.0 - 2.2.19 and 2.3.0 - 2.3.11, the Spring AMQP Message object, in its toString() method, will create a new String object from the message body, regardless of its size. This can cause an OOM Error with a large message
nvd
CVE-2021-22097MEDIUMCVSS 6.5≥ 2.2.0, ≤ 2.2.18≥ 2.3.0, ≤ 2.3.102021-10-28
CVE-2021-22097 [MEDIUM] CWE-502 CVE-2021-22097: In Spring AMQP versions 2.2.0 - 2.2.18 and 2.3.0 - 2.3.10, the Spring AMQP Message object, in its to In Spring AMQP versions 2.2.0 - 2.2.18 and 2.3.0 - 2.3.10, the Spring AMQP Message object, in its toString() method, will deserialize a body for a message with content type application/x-java-serialized-object. It is possible to construct a malicious java.util.Dictionary object that can cause 100% CPU usage in the application if the toString() metho
nvd
CVE-2016-2173CRITICALCVSS 9.8fixed in 1.5.52017-04-21
CVE-2016-2173 [CRITICAL] CWE-20 CVE-2016-2173: org.springframework.core.serializer.DefaultDeserializer in Spring AMQP before 1.5.5 allows remote at org.springframework.core.serializer.DefaultDeserializer in Spring AMQP before 1.5.5 allows remote attackers to execute arbitrary code.
nvd